#446514 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#446514 is composed of 26.7% red, 39.6%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.2%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 84.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 23.7%. #446514 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ca28 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#446514 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#446514 has RGB values of R:68, G:101,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 4482324.

Shades and Tints of #446514
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#446514
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d4039 is the less saturated color, while #477801 is the most saturated one.
